示例#1
0
 def test_del_node_attribute(self):
     n = {'id': 'a1', 'key': b'1234',
           'attrib': {'attrib1': 123},
           'children': []}
     d = DataTree(n)
     a = d.get_node_attrib('/a1', 'attrib1')
     self.assertEqual(a, 123)
     d.del_node_attrib('/a1', 'attrib1')
     a = d.get_node_attrib('/a1', 'attrib1')
     self.assertEqual(a, None)
示例#2
0
 def test_add_node_attribute(self):
     n = {'id': 'a1', 'key': b'1234', 'children': []}
     d = DataTree(n)
     d.add_node_attrib('/a1', 'attrib1', 123)
     a = d.get_node_attrib('/a1', 'attrib1')
     self.assertEqual(a, 123)